Download the Axis Bank Statement
There are three major ways in Axis Bank to download statements: Netbanking, Mobile Banking, or Email. Hereunder, we present a step-by-step process for each method.
Netbanking
Following are the applicable steps to download Axis Bank statement via Net Banking:
- Step 1: Visit the official website of Axis Bank.
- Step 2: Log in to your Internet banking account using your login credentials.
- Step 3: View your account details in the ‘My Account’ section.
- Step 4: Select the specific account for which you need the statement.
- Step 5: Click on the Detailed Account Statement option.
- Step 6: Specify the date range for which you want the statement and choose the format as PDF.
- Step 7: Click Download or View Statement to receive your statement on your device.
Mobile Banking
Let’s examine the applicable steps on how to download Axis Bank statements via Mobile Banking:
- Step 1: Download the Axis Mobile Banking app on your smartphone.
- Step 2: Open the app and Log in with your customer ID and password.
- Step 3: Tap on the ‘Accounts’ section and select the account for which you wish to get the statement.
- Step 4: Opt for the ‘View Statement’ option and choose the date range for the statement.
- Step 5: Click on the Download icon and select format as PDF.
- Step 6: The statement will be downloaded to your device
- Step 7: You can view or share it at your convenience.
Axis Bank statement download via Email is the most popular method among others. You only need to send an SMS to 56161600 from your registered mobile number with the bank. The SMS format should be “ESTMT <last 5 digits of account number> <From Date> <To Date>.” For example, “ESTMT 12345 01-01-2024 31-01-2024.” In a matter of seconds, you will receive the statement on your registered email ID.
You can further sign up for monthly e-statements online. It enables you to receive your bank statement each month automatically. To facilitate this service, log into your Internet banking account, locate “My Profile,” and opt for the “Contact Details Update” option to update your email ID. You will then receive your consolidated account statement at your updated email ID once every month.
Axis Bank Statement Password Combination
You require a password to open the Axis Bank statement, downloaded in a PDF format. It is typically a combination of your name’s first four letters and either the last four digits of your account number or the four digits of your date of birth. Notably, the four letters of your name would be in UPPER CASE as it appears on your statement. To illustrate, suppose your name is Sandeep Kumar, and your account number is 1234567890; your password could be SAND7890 or RAVI0101 (if your date of birth is 01-01-1994).
